Output ddd17a0d43d93fcbad93ce230ebafa6457a83c5955de06d7675420e51d45200e:1

value
2619000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a957058342c7221dc4c25e92ebc37e402573900e OP_EQUAL
address
3H8QNKpWsJhTFzL1ZwoB6n6UxwQoy9WNtR
transaction
ddd17a0d43d93fcbad93ce230ebafa6457a83c5955de06d7675420e51d45200e
spent
true